Put Down the Books and Head Out of the House
Litquake is San Francisco’s literary festival.
Since our inception in 1999 our mission has been to galvanize the Bay Area’s already thriving literary scene by bringing emerging, mid-career and established local authors together with fans of the written word for nine days of readings, panel discussions, themed events, and general literary mayhem.
Litquake is for folks who get excited by reading, writing or both. It is an opportunity to put down the books and head out of the house to a bar, movie theater, park, or auditorium to hear your favorite writers read, perform or just talk.
This year’s festival—featuring over 300 authors over 8 days—will take place October 6-13, 2007.
Litquake has been featured or mentioned in a number of print articles, radio programs as well as blogs, including the San Francisco Chronicle, 7 x 7 magazine, San Francisco magazine, the Contra Costa Times, USA Today, London’s Guardian, West Coast Live, KALW, KGO,C-SPAN Book TV, Air America Radio and more.
